PRESIDENT REAGAN'S VISIT TO THE UK 2 SECRETARY OF STATE'S MEETING WITH MR
3 JUNE: BRIEFING FOR THE SHULTZ: 3 JUNE
The Secretary of State will meet Mr Shultz for a bilateral, probably at breakfast 0745 to 0900 on 3 June.
1.
This meeting, (like the Prime Minister's with President Reagan on 2 June see my separate minute of today's date) will probably be dominated by summit issues. But there will be more scope for a
2.
wider agenda. In addition to summit issues, burdensharing, Arab/Israel, the Gulf, Southern Africa, EC/US Trade, the UN and Northern Ireland are topics that immediately come to mind. There will obviously be others (we already have some bids).
We would be grateful if Departments would let us know (Mark Higson, 270 2663) if they wish to contribute to the briefing why, by Friday, 20 May.
